Default how to read Bhavcopy in metastock



I would like to know is there a way to convert Bhavcopy of nse from csv / dbf format to metastock readable format.

Sara,

Perhaps you have already found out how to do this, but here it is anyway.

1) Download file in csv format.

2) Double click to open with Excel.

3) Right click on the K (Timestamp) column to select the whole column and choose "cut".

4) Right click on A (Symbol) column and click " Insert cut cells".

5) Again right click on the column header to highlight the whole column and click "format cells".

6) Number -> Date -> Type. Choose mm-dd-yy. Ok.

7) Delete columns C ("Series"), H ("Last"), I ("Prevclose") and K ("Tottrdval").

8) Now is the important part. In the first row change :

TIMESTAMP to <Date>

SYMBOL to <Ticker>

OPEN to <open>

HIGH to <High>

LOW to <Low>

CLOSE to <Close>

TOTTRDQTY to <Volume>.

9) Save the file.

10) Use the Downloader to convert the data to metastock format. Source file type should be ASCII text and while browsing in "Files of Type" choose "All Files".
